网络监控传输系统如何支持高并发访问?
在当今信息爆炸的时代,网络监控传输系统在各个行业中的应用越来越广泛。然而,随着用户数量的激增和业务需求的不断提高,如何支持高并发访问成为了一个亟待解决的问题。本文将深入探讨网络监控传输系统如何应对高并发访问的挑战,并提供一些解决方案。
一、高并发访问的挑战
带宽压力:高并发访问意味着短时间内有大量数据需要传输,这给网络带宽带来了巨大的压力。
服务器负载:服务器需要处理大量的请求,这可能导致服务器负载过高,影响系统的稳定性。
数据一致性:在高并发环境下,如何保证数据的一致性是一个难题。
用户体验:高并发访问可能会影响用户体验,如页面加载缓慢、响应时间过长等。
二、网络监控传输系统支持高并发访问的解决方案
优化网络架构
- 负载均衡:通过负载均衡技术,将访问请求分配到多个服务器上,减轻单个服务器的压力。
- CDN加速:利用CDN(内容分发网络)技术,将数据缓存到全球多个节点,降低用户访问延迟。
提升服务器性能
- 硬件升级:提高服务器的CPU、内存和存储等硬件配置,提升处理能力。
- 软件优化:优化服务器软件,提高其并发处理能力。
数据一致性保障
- 分布式数据库:采用分布式数据库技术,实现数据的横向扩展,提高数据一致性。
- 读写分离:将读操作和写操作分离,提高数据库的并发处理能力。
缓存机制
- 内存缓存:将热点数据缓存到内存中,减少数据库访问,提高系统性能。
- 缓存一致性:保证缓存数据的一致性,避免出现数据不一致的问题。
优化业务逻辑
- 异步处理:将耗时的业务逻辑异步处理,提高系统响应速度。
- 限流策略:设置合理的限流策略,防止系统过载。
三、案例分析
某电商平台:该平台在春节期间,用户访问量激增。通过采用CDN加速、负载均衡等技术,成功应对了高并发访问的挑战,保证了用户体验。
某在线教育平台:该平台采用分布式数据库和缓存机制,实现了数据的横向扩展和一致性保障,有效应对了高并发访问。
总结
网络监控传输系统支持高并发访问是一个复杂的过程,需要从多个方面进行优化。通过优化网络架构、提升服务器性能、保障数据一致性、引入缓存机制和优化业务逻辑等措施,可以有效应对高并发访问的挑战。在实际应用中,还需根据具体业务需求进行定制化优化,以实现最佳效果。
猜你喜欢:业务性能指标